Make drawers...
How high do you need to go and how high can your pet step up?
If you made a set of drawers that fit under the bed, and then put a cover on the top of each drawer, you would have storage, and steps.
So make a set of drawers.
Inside each drawer, put a strip of wood on each side.
Place a piece of plywood on the wood.
You now have storage-steps.
